CASE STUDY
It is our sincere pleasure to continually manage the Buffalo Soldiers National Museum social media, email, capital campaigns, and exhibitions for almost four years now. We are helping them coordinate their interior in the next year. As part of our ongoing retainer, we have helped them secure TV broadcasts in over 80+ markets, helped bring social media influencers to their site or gotten them featured on podcasts, facilitated collaborations with other major partners in the Houston area, such as Space Center, etc. We have also supported them on capital campaigns as part of our retainer and helped secure over $11 million in three years using our deliverables. We are currently helping make their facility and marketing efforts friendlier to the Hispanic markets, which are currently the largest and fastest-growing in Houston.
CASE STUDY
MBF helps build hospitals around the world by building entire medical systems and educating the local populations in the latest nursing techniques. For example, we have run a fundraising campaign to get “first breath” training to nurses handling newborns or to get “Mother’s Day” cards to moms in their Malawi maternity wards.
Their main concern was that they didn’t have a brand, so we first helped with developing a brand, from fonts and colors and custom iconography, to how they discuss the life-saving work they do. They have limited photography and no way to take new photography on the regular, so the work was very graphic-based and boosted with ads, depending on data to drive action.
CASE STUDY
East End Houston’s Cultural District reached out to us for a full marketing plan and campaign surrounding their 2-mile mural project. We helped them create and distribute a series of bilingual social media videos. We created custom landing pages on their website with interactive maps leading to each mural and a page per artist, translated in English and Spanish.
The social media posts reached an engagement record for them, spiked their website visits, and drove email signups and visits to the murals. No ads were used for this campaign. It was completely organic, utilizing video content and consistency for reach.
The plan extended beyond social media. We helped outline possible scavenger hunts, partnerships, interactive elements, walking tours of their artwork, corporate funding opportunities, and more.
In February 2025, just helped them run the Fall in Love with East End campaign which reached over 3.5 million households and had record social media reach, above those listed below.

Gracie was born in Camaguey, Cuba, and immigrated at the age of six to Miami with her parents, brother, and whatever possessions they could fit into suitcases. None of them had ever left the island nor spoke English and her parents’ university degrees were suddenly worthless. Her mother managed to find work as a graphic designer in a Spanish-language newspaper for over a decade before cancer forced her to retire early. Gracie spent six years by her bedside in hospitals while also attending her local university and working full time as a designer herself, until her mother was finally declared cancer-free.
In 2016, she was selected to be graphic designer for Houston Grand Opera. She packed up all her belongings once again, this time into her little Hyundai hatchback, and started anew in Houston, Texas. A mere year later, at the age of 26, she had enough contacts and clients to start Padrón Design Studio, which offered digital marketing services to mostly performing arts nonprofits and small businesses.
Her business grew approximately 30% per year, slowly but confidently, until COVID-19. Nonprofits were suddenly forced to pivot to digital marketing to keep their programs alive and 20 new clients joined in 2020 alone. Gracie was forced to hire quickly as she had just given birth to her first son and couldn’t handle the workload. In 2022, the company was renamed Padrón & Co. to better capture the wide range of services offered.
After seven years as founder, creative director, and lead marketing strategist, Gracie and her team have helped over 100 companies grow their causes, raise more money, reach more people in need, and get more visitors to their sites. Her capital campaigns have helped nonprofits bring in over $25 million in donations and grants, and her work with small businesses has helped them bring in over $100 million in new work.
